TUT Late Application 2018

GENERAL

  • It is in your interest to submit your application as soon as possible and not to wait until the closing date for applications.

If you were registered at the TUT for the previous academic term or part thereof, you need not complete this form again. (Re-admission)

  • Applicants in need of accommodation must also complete this form.
  • The potential of applicants for all courses will be evaluated.

If you wish to alter your choice at a later stage, you must do so in writing. (Alter your study choices at TUT)

  • Documents that are sent by fax are not acceptable.
  • Processing of application will be delayed if form is not fully completed, or if all required documents are not attached, or if the administration fee is not enclosed, or if the application reaches the University after the relevant closing date.
  • The University must be notified immediately of any change of address, contact details or e-mail addresses after the submission of this application.
  • The reference number allocated to you must be quoted in all further correspondence.
  • Should you, after submission of application, decide not to continue with your studies or to change your course, notify the Registrar of your decision immediately in writing.
  • The University retains the right to refuse any application without stating reasons.
  • All non-South African citizens must submit a study permit before registration. Provisional acceptance does not imply exemption from this requirement.
  • Applicants will be informed in separate letters whether their applications for admission, financial assistance and accommodation were successful.

ADMISSION REQUIREMENTS

  • Consult the brochure of the faculty concerned to find out whether you meet the admission requirements for your proposed study field. Please refer to General Information First Years

DOCUMENTS

  • Certified copies of the following documents must accompany each application/or be uploaded on the system:
  • All applicants
    • Identity document (South African citizens)
    • Passport document (non-South African citizens)
  • Applicants for certificates, diplomas and degrees
    • Senior Certificate/National Senior Certificate or equivalent qualification.
    • An academic record in respect of studies at another tertiary institution.
  • Applicants for BTech and Post-graduate studies
    • Official proof that all the requirements for a diploma or degree have been met.

CAMPUS

  • Find out beforehand whether the course of your choice is actually presented at the campus you are applying for. Your application will be considered only in respect of one campus. If you are accepted for a course, such acceptance applies only to the campus concerned and it is not transferable.

UNIVERSITY RESIDENCES

  • Accommodation in residences is available only in eMalahleni, Ga-Rankuwa, Nelspruit, Soshanguve and Pretoria, and only for bona fide day-class students.

AWARDING OF STATUS

  • Prospective students who obtained qualifications at other higher education institutions must apply on the prescribed application form to be granted a certain status for further studies at TUT.

RECOGNITION AND EXEMPTION OF SUBJECTS

  • If you have already obtained credit(s) for a course and/or subjects at a higher education institution, you could possibly qualify for recognition of those subjects and/or exemption from corresponding subjects at TUT. You must submit your application in this regard on the prescribed form.

SUBMISSION OF APPLICATIONS

  • Your application and all correspondence must be sent to the campus where you intend studying.

LANGUAGE POLICY

  • In accordance with the language policy of TUT, the language medium for lectures is English.

LATE APPLICATIONS

  • Will only be considered if space is available
  • Applicants must establish whether space in a course is available before submitting an application.
